Exploring the Wonders of Kilmurry and Surrounding Ballymulcashel
The location of Kilmurry, Ballymulcashel, is a significant drawcard for visitors seeking an authentic Irish experience. Situated in County Clare, this region is rich in history, natural beauty, and traditional culture. Days can be filled with exploring ancient sites, discovering charming villages, and immersing yourself in the vibrant local life. The proximity to stunning landscapes makes it an ideal base for both relaxation and adventure.
County Clare is famous for its dramatic coastline, including the iconic Cliffs of Moher, which are within a reasonable driving distance from Kilmurry. The unique karst landscape of the Burren National Park, with its rare flora and fascinating geological formations, is another must-see. These natural wonders offer breathtaking vistas and incredible opportunities for hiking and photography.
Beyond the natural attractions, the area is dotted with historical sites, from ancient ring forts to medieval castles. Visitors can delve into Ireland’s rich past by exploring these fascinating remnants. Quaint towns and villages offer a chance to experience authentic Irish hospitality, enjoy traditional music sessions in local pubs, and sample delicious regional cuisine. The pace of life here is wonderfully unhurried, allowing for genuine connection and discovery.

Packing for a log cabin stay in Ireland, especially in Kilmurry, Ballymulcashel, requires a practical approach. Layers are key, as the weather can be unpredictable. Waterproof jackets and sturdy walking shoes are essential for exploring the outdoors. Don’t forget insect repellent, especially if you plan on spending evenings outdoors during the warmer months. Bringing a good book and some board games can also enhance your relaxation time.
